Following Your BMW’s Recommended Service Schedule
As a BMW owner, you are entitled to an owner’s manual; this provides necessary information as to the additional long-term care and maintenance of your luxury auto that it will need to sustain its performance. This manual presents the service intervals that should be taken for your BMW to maintain the car in the best condition. If you are unsure of what your vehicle requires or do not have the time to go through it all, that is quite fine; we have summarized it for you. Here is a summary of the primary services and the duration that should elapse before the services are taken so that you know what your BMW requires for optimal performance.
- Oil and Filter Change: Lubrication in the engine keeps it working, but at the same time, oils over time absorb several impurities; therefore, failure to replace it on time, advisably once a year or every 10,000 miles, one runs the risk of overheating or straining the engine.
- Brake maintenance and inspection: Since the brake is one of the main parts that helps to ensure driving safety, you should have your car’s brakes inspected every 20,000 miles to prevent safety compromises and to avoid wearing the rotors and pads.
- Check the rotation and alignment of the tires: You do not want to face discomfort or unstable situations while driving. Therefore, after running 10,000 miles, have it checked by some professional regarding its rotation and alignment so that all tires wear equally and handle correctly.
- Air Filter Replacement: Since the engine requires air for it to work, you will want to replace the air filter from time to time, and this should be done after approximately 15000-30000 miles so your engine doesn’t suck in contaminated air, which hurts performance.
- Coolant System Inspection: Whenever the engine is on, the coolant helps prevent it from overheating by cooling it down to an acceptable level. Hence, to ensure it is okay, it should be checked frequently, particularly after every 30,000 miles.
- Spark Plug Replacement: Over time, this part will wear down and has to be changed every 60,000 miles because it must work to ignite the fuel mix inside of an engine.
- Detailed Check-up: Finally, at the end of everything, yearly, your vehicle should be sent to an expert to perform a thorough check-up of its various systems to inspect any indication of wear and tear.
The Importance of Regular Maintenance for Longevity
Regular maintenance is the key to keeping your car running long, especially a high-performance vehicle like a BMW. Servicing entails regular check-ups of all parts to ensure they work correctly, eliminating breakdowns or expensive servicing. Maintenance activities like oil changes, brake checks, and tire rotation reduce stress on essential components, and your BMW will be running to its optimum potential for years.
It also ensures that faults can be observed and fixed early enough by following the maintenance schedule recommended by the manufacturer. If done correctly, car maintenance enhances its general reliability and safety, as well as its fuel efficiency and durability or life span.
Lack of regular maintenance has the most significant consequences: your automobile ages before its age, there will be a decrease in performance, and it will also cost a lower resale value when selling. You can protect your investment and continue to enjoy the best driving experience BMW is known for by prioritizing routine maintenance.
